Insteel Still Busy Hosting Legislators
|
On August 12, Rep. Michael Castle (R-DE) visited the Insteel Wire Products plant in Wilmington. Bill Davis, General Manager, took this opportunity to explain the effects antidumping and countervailing duty orders on downstream producers of steel wire products.
During the plant tour, Castle was able to inspect some mesh being produced and see some site preparation for additional equipment. The Congressman appeared very interested in federal trade legislation and how it affects Insteel's business as a downstream user of steel.
